1. Important Safety Instructions
- Read all instructions before using the appliance.
- Do not touch hot surfaces. Use handles or knobs.
- To protect against fire, electric shock, and injury to persons, do not immerse cord, plugs, or appliance in water or other liquid.
- Close supervision is necessary when any appliance is used by or near children.
- Unplug from outlet when not in use and before cleaning. Allow to cool before putting on or taking off parts, and before cleaning the appliance.
- Do not operate any appliance with a damaged cord or plug or after the appliance malfunctions, or has been damaged in any manner.
- The use of accessory attachments not recommended by the appliance manufacturer may result in fire, electric shock, or injury to persons.
- Do not use outdoors.
- Do not let cord hang over edge of table or counter, or touch hot surfaces.
- Do not place on or near a hot gas or electric burner, or in a heated oven.
- Always attach plug to appliance first, then plug cord into the wall outlet. To disconnect, turn any control to "off", then remove plug from wall outlet.
- Do not use appliance for other than intended use.

4. Operating Instructions
4.1 Capsule and Coffee Powder Usage
The Cafelffe MK-609S supports various brewing methods using dedicated adapters.
Nes Original Capsule Adapter
- Place a Nes Original capsule into its dedicated adapter.
- Insert the loaded adapter into the machine.
- Select your desired water volume. It is recommended to use below level 2 for rich crema.

Ground Coffee Adapter
- Add approximately 15g of ground coffee into the ground coffee adapter.
- Use the provided tamper to flatten the coffee powder evenly.
- Insert the loaded adapter into the machine.
- Select your desired water volume.
Image: Ground Coffee Adapter

Ground coffee is being added and tamped into the dedicated adapter for the Cafelffe MK-609S coffee machine.
ESE Pod Adapter
- Remove the powder filter from the ground coffee adapter base.
- Insert the ESE filter into the adapter base.
- Place a 44mm ESE pod into the adapter.
- Insert the loaded adapter into the machine.
- Select your desired water volume.

4.2 Brewing Modes
Hot Brewing Mode
Quickly press the ON/OFF button to enter the hot brewing mode. The indicator light will display in RED.
Cold Brewing Mode
Press and hold the ON/OFF button for 5 seconds to enter the cold brewing mode. The indicator light will display in BLUE. To switch back to hot brewing mode from cold brew, quickly press the ON/OFF button twice.
4.3 Programmable Settings
Temperature Regulation (85°C - 99°C)
- Long press the Coffee button for 3 seconds to enter the temperature regulation mode. The temperature indicator will flash.
- Click the Water Volume button to switch between desired temperatures.
- Wait for 3 seconds until the flashing stops, indicating the temperature setting is successful.
Water Volume Regulation
Click the Water Volume button to choose the desired water volume for your brew.
Customizable Pre-infusion Mode
Press and hold the Water Volume button and the Coffee button simultaneously for 5 seconds to toggle the pre-infusion function on or off. When the Coffee button indicator light is ON, pre-infusion is active (defaults to 3 seconds). When the light is OFF, pre-infusion is deactivated, and the machine will extract coffee directly.
Custom Energy-Saving Mode
Press and hold the Water Volume button and the Coffee button simultaneously for 5 seconds to enter the energy-saving adjustment mode. The Water Volume button indicator light OFF cancels the energy-saving mode, while ON activates it.
Restore Factory Settings
Press and hold the ON/OFF button and Water Volume button at the same time. The indicator lights will light up and flash twice, indicating that the machine has been restored to default mode.

5. Cleaning & Maintenance
5.1 Cleaning Needle Usage
Use the provided cleaning needle to clean the piercing pin on the Dolce Gusto (DG) adapters. This helps prevent clogging and ensures consistent coffee flow.
5.2 Washing Adapters
The coffee adapters can be washed with water. After washing, ensure they are thoroughly dried before re-inserting them into the machine.
5.3 Descaling Mode
Regular descaling is crucial for maintaining machine performance and longevity. It is recommended to descale every 3 months.
- Fill the water tank with water and add a descaling agent (not included).
- Insert an empty adapter (without any capsule or powder) into the machine.
- Place an empty cup under the dispenser.
- Press and hold the Coffee button first, then press and hold the ON/OFF button for 5 seconds. The machine will beep twice.
- Once the Coffee button and ON/OFF button lights are lit up, press the Coffee button to activate the descaling function. The descaling process takes approximately 120 seconds.
5.4 Pump Pipe Usage (for long-term storage)
If the machine will not be used for a long period, use the black pump pipe to pump out any remaining water from the internal circuit.
- Insert the pump pipe into the water entrance.
- Fill water into the pipe.
- Inject the water from the pipe into the machine until the internal circuit is filled with water. This helps prevent internal components from drying out.

6.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Machine does not turn on | No power supply | Check if the power cord is properly plugged into the outlet and the machine. |
| No coffee/water dispensed | Water tank empty | Fill the water tank with purified water. |
| Adapter clogged | Clean the piercing pin using the cleaning needle. Ensure the capsule/pod is correctly inserted. | |
| Coffee is too weak/strong | Incorrect water volume setting | Adjust the water volume setting to your preference. |
| Coffee grounds/capsule issue | Ensure fresh coffee grounds are used and tamped correctly, or that capsules/pods are not deformed. | |
| Water leaks from machine | Water tank not properly installed | Ensure the water tank is securely seated in its position. |
| Drip tray full | Empty and clean the drip tray. | |
| Machine not heating up | Heating element issue | Contact customer support if the issue persists after checking power. |
7. Specifications
- Brand: CAFELFFE
- Model: MK-609S
- Color: Black
- Product Dimensions: 28 x 14 x 26.5 cm
- Capacity: 600 Milliliters
- Power / Wattage: 1450 watts
- Voltage: 220 Volts
- Material: Metal, Polypropylene
- Auto Shutoff: Yes (after 15 minutes idle)
- Special Features: Auto Clean Function, Auto Shut-Off, Lightweight, Removable Tank, Single Cup Brew, Hot/Cold Brew, 19 Bar Pressure, Adjustable Water Levels, Temperature Control
- Item Weight: 3.17 Kilograms
